Comparison review

The Moto Z4 is just a bit better than Samsung Galaxy Alpha, getting a general score of 79.8 against 76.3. Both phones in this comparison review come with Android operating system, but Moto Z4 has an older 10 version while Samsung Galaxy Alpha has Android 4.4.4 version. Moto Z4 is a somewhat thicker and incredibly heavier phone than the Samsung Galaxy Alpha.

The Galaxy Alpha features a little better performance than Moto Z4, because although it has a lower number of cores and a lower amount of RAM, it also counts with an additional GPU. The Galaxy Alpha has a little more vivid screen than Moto Z4, although it has a much lower resolution of 1280 x 720, a quite worse amount of pixels per inch of screen and a way smaller display.

Moto Z4 counts with a much better storage to install applications and games than Samsung Galaxy Alpha, because it has a slot for external memory cards that holds up to 512 GB and 96 GB more internal storage capacity. Moto Z4 features a really longer battery performance than Samsung Galaxy Alpha, because it has a 3600mAh battery size instead of 1860mAh.

The Moto Z4 features a way better camera than Galaxy Alpha, and although they both have the same video frame rates and the same video resolution, the Moto Z4 also has a much more MP back facing camera and a much bigger diafragm aperture for better photography in low-light situations.

Although Moto Z4 is a better device, it is way more expensive than the Galaxy Alpha, and it doesn't have such a good relation between it's price and quality as Galaxy Alpha. If you want to save a few dollars, you can buy Galaxy Alpha, letting go a couple features and specs, but you will get the most out of your money.
